China sets pace for green energy
By Zheng Jinran and Yang Jun in Guiyang | China Daily | Updated: 2016-07-11 09:03
Country expects to reach its goals well ahead of stated 2030 deadline
China has cut coal consumption by 1.57 billion metric tons from 2010 to 2015 to reduce carbon emissions by 3.6 billion tons. And it has shown a commitment to green energy by becoming the largest country with renewable power capacity in 2015.
An estimated 147 gigawatts of renewable power capacity was added worldwide in 2015, the largest annual increase ever, and global investment also climbed to a record high, the annual Global Status Report on Renewables 2016 said.
